Limited double gray, green, smoke splatter vinyl LP pressing. 2025 release from post-punk icon Kirk Brandon and his band Spear of Destiny. "This is an album that has been virtually 2 years in the making. To clarify what it is... The 1980s Virgin Records album's 'The Price You Pay' and 'Outland' we have re-recorded. The reason is that I wanted them to sound as close to what I originally thought they should have sounded like. Which is way different from what both albums did in fact end up sounding like. So, with the musicians I have largely been playing with for the last 20+ years, we went back, as we did with 'Grapes of Wrath' 'One Eyed Jacks' and 'World Service', and done interesting, I hope, reinterpretations of my original ideas. The track selection on 'Janus' is my own selection from each album's time period. This includes B Sides/12-inch songs that I really felt should have been on these two albums but were omitted by the company as not being presumably commercial enough. I beg to differ and are here now included on this re-recording." - Kirk Brandon.
